Lionfish: An Incredible Edible Fish
It’s believed that lionfish, a popular Indo-Pacific aquarium fish, was first released in Florida’s Atlantic waters during the 1980s. Now lionfish prey voraciously on invertebrates and over 70 species of domestic fish. And these toothy coral reef fish, part of the scorpion fish family, have no natural reef predators except spearfishing humans.

Sweet Key Lime Pie Flavors the Keys
Few people visit the Florida Keys without sampling a few pieces of Key lime pie, renowned as the island chain’s signature dessert. Millions of slices of the tart, creamy treat — voted the official pie of Florida by the state legislature in 2006 (yes, really!) — are savored every year by Keys visitors and locals.
